It's more a case of Mike falling back rather than moving on. Changing directions does not necessarily mean evolving or progressing as an artist. As I said before, he used to have a much better sense of sound and track structure than he seems to have now, there's hardly anything interesting to be found in this new release (I'm talking about the Main Mix now). I invite you to compare one of the Push remixes from 2001/2002 to Changes 'r Good. You can't look past the difference in terms of sound quality.

I'm all up for new sounds, but it feels as though Mike is trying too hard to be different at the moment.


(Note: all of the above concerns his trance aliases, somehow he does manage to produce decent material under the Galore guise, Kriss Rider etc.)
